Rare variants in Toll-like receptor 7 results in functional impairment and downregulation of cytokine-mediated signaling in COVID-19 patients

Abstract: Toll-like receptors (TLR) are crucial components in the initiation of innate immune responses to a variety of pathogens, triggering the production of pro-inflammatory cytokines and type I and II interferons, which are responsible for innate antiviral responses. Among the different TLRs, TLR7 recognizes several single-stranded RNA viruses including SARS-CoV-2. We and others identified rare loss-of-function variants in X-chromosomal TLR7 in young men with severe COVID-19 and with no prior history of major chroni… Show more

“…The impaired signal pathways of TLR7 were associated with the changes of mRNA CXCL10. It was reported that the CXCL10 mRNA was significantly decreased in two rare variants of TLR7: 920Lys and Asp41Glu in patients with SARS-CoV-2 infection in comparison to healthy donors [ 61 ]. The Described study is in accordance with previous findings focusing on the role of TLR7 and CXCL10, which is directly associated with TLR7 in severe course of COVID-19 [ 59 , 61 ].…”
